Biggie, Eazy-E & MC Ren Net Worth: Comparing Hip-Hop Legends' Riches

Biggie, Eazy-E, and MC Ren each built distinct legacies that continue shaping hip-hop culture and wealth discussions. Their net worth trajectories reflect different career paths, business decisions, and industry eras.

While fans often compare their incomes and estates, the financial stories behind the names reveal how artistry, entrepreneurship, and timing influence long term net worth.

Artist Primary Era Peak Eras Reputed Net Worth at Peak Key Revenue Drivers
Biggie 1990s East Coast 1994–1997 Est. $10 million at time of death Album sales, royalties, features, endorsements
Eazy-E 1980s–1990s West Coast 1987–1995 Est. $8–10 million at peak Ruthless Records, touring, merch, investments
MC Ren 1980s–1990s N.W.A 1988–1993 Est. $6–8 million at peak N.W.A royalties, solo albums, production
